BACKGROUND:
In December 2016 the Council requested that staff evaluate the temporal distribution of halibut prohibited species catch (PSC) during the Western Gulf of Alaska (GOA) trawl Pacific cod A season. The Council asked staff to focus on describing changes in the halibut PSC rate as the A season progresses.
The discussion paper describes the management landscape for the Pacific cod in the Gulf, including allocation of cod by area and sector, the apportionment of halibut PSC to the Pacific cod fishery, and monitoring of cod and halibut through catch accounting. The analysis contrasts PSC rates for vessels +/- 58’ LOA and explores inter-annual patterns.
